Insurance Transformed: AI and Predictive Analytics
Wiki Article
The insurance industry is undergoing a transformation driven by the immense capabilities of artificial intelligence (AI). Predictive analytics, a key component of AI, is altering the way insurers operate, from evaluating risk to tailoring policies. By analyzing vast datasets of customer information and industry trends, predictive models can effectively forecast future events, enabling insurers to reduce losses and enhance their bottom line.
- Utilizing AI-powered predictive analytics allows insurers to identify high-risk individuals or behaviors, consequently enabling them to modify premiums accordingly.
- Predictive models can also be used to detect fraudulent claims, reducing costs associated with coverage fraud.
- Additionally, predictive analytics empowers insurers to design more specific policies that meet the distinct needs of their customers.
In conclusion, predictive analytics is modernizing the insurance industry by providing insurers with the tools to perform more data-driven decisions, leading to boosted efficiency, profitability, and customer satisfaction.

Customer Service Transformation: AI Chatbots Enhance the Policy Experience
The insurance industry is undergoing a dramatic click here transformation, with Cognitive Intelligence (AI) at the forefront of this advancement. One of the most promising applications of AI in insurance is the rise of chatbots, which are revolutionizing customer service by providing instant, effective support. These intelligent virtual assistants can handle a wide spectrum of customer inquiries, from inquiring about policy details to filing claims and even offering personalized guidance.
By streamlining routine tasks, chatbots free up human agents to focus their time to more complex issues, ultimately enhancing the overall customer experience. Furthermore, AI-powered chatbots can adapt from each interaction, becoming increasingly efficient over time. This continuous improvement ensures that customers receive the most helpful information and support available.
- Chatbots provide always-available customer service, addressing inquiries whenever needed.
- They offer a convenient way for customers to communicate with their insurance provider.
- AI chatbots can help minimize wait times and improve customer satisfaction.
Streamlining Claims with AI: Boosting Resolution Speeds
The insurance industry is undergoing a significant transformation, driven by the rapid advancements in artificial intelligence (AI). AI-powered systems are revolutionizing claims processing, significantly improving claim resolution rates and streamlining the overall process. By automating laborious tasks and leveraging machine learning algorithms, AI can analyze claims data with remarkable accuracy and efficiency. This not only reduces processing time but also minimizes errors and improves customer satisfaction.
- Automated systems can quickly process large volumes of claims data, identifying patterns and inconsistencies that may be missed by human reviewers.
- Machine learning algorithms can forecast claim costs with high accuracy, allowing insurers to make strategic decisions.
- Real-time data analysis enables AI systems to identify potential fraud and mitigate financial losses.
